A race condition vulnerability in the Payments feature of Google Chrome prior to version 153.0.8010.36 allows remote attackers to exploit social engineering tactics to spoof user interface elements through a specially crafted HTML page. This could lead to unauthorized actions or data exposure, making it crucial for users and organizations relying on Chrome for secure transactions to prioritize updates. Users should ensure they are running the latest version to mitigate potential risks associated with this vulnerability.

Original NVD Description

Race condition in Payments in Google Chrome prior to 153.0.8010.36 allowed a remote attacker leveraging social engineering to spoof UI elements via a crafted HTML page. (Chromium security severity: Medium)
